    Notizen: Brillouin light scattering was used to obtain elastic and piezoelectric constants for a single domain orthorhombic KNbO3 single crystal at room temperature and pressure. More than 320 measurements of longitudinal and transverse acoustic wave velocities were obtained in 160 different crystallographic directions. An inversion of these data using the literature values for the dielectric permittivity of KNbO3 resulted in the full set of elastic and piezoelectric constants for the material. It is suggested that the difference between piezoelectric constants obtained by high- and low-frequency methods could be explained by the high-frequency relaxation-type dispersion for the dielectric constant ε33 in the GHz region by analogy with BaTiO3. The directional dependence of electromechanical coupling for longitudinal and transverse acoustic waves in KNbO3 was analyzed. The obtained elastic constants were (in GPa): CE11=224(4), CE22=273(5), CE33=245(5), CE44=75(1), CE55=28.5(5), CE66=95(2), CE12=102(5), CE13=182(10), CE23=130(6), where E denotes constant electric field strength.

    Notizen: The Hall resistivity ρxy of a La2/3(Ca,Pb)1/3MnO3 single crystal has been measured as a function of temperature and field. The overall behavior is similar to that observed previously in thin-film samples. At 5 K, ρxy is positive and linear in field, indicating that the anomalous contribution is negligible. However, the slope is small and, if a free carrier, single band model were used, the carrier density would be 2.4 holes per unit cell, even larger than the 0.85–1.9 holes per cell that have been reported using thin-film data and far larger than the 0.33 holes per cell expected from the doping level. As the temperature is increased, a strong, negative contribution to ρxy appears, due to the anomalous contribution to the Hall effect. Making use of a detailed measurement of the magnetization M(B,T), we separate the ordinary (∝B) and anomalous (∝M) contributions. The anomalous contribution is negative and proportional to the zero-field resistivity ρxx below TC, indicating that magnetic skew scattering is the dominant mechanism in the metallic ferromagnetic regime. Far above TC, ρxy shows a negative slope, and is to be associated with the hopping of small polarons. Above TC, the Hall mobility is field independent despite the changes in ρxx and nonlinear ρxy. © 1999 American Institute of Physics.

    Notizen: A new type of dissociated misfit dislocation in [001] ZnTe/GaAs strained-layer heterostructures was studied using high-resolution electron microscopy. These dislocations can relieve the localized misfit strain, since they belong to either dissociated screw dislocations and/or partial dislocation dipoles. Their generation depends upon a localized negative strain. © 1998 American Institute of Physics.

    Notizen: Superconducting coatings in the system Bi-Ca-Sr-Cu-O were deposited on alumina substrates by plasma spray methods. The coatings were superconducting in the "as-sprayed'' condition and improved with heat treatment. The best results were for coatings with resistivity values near 10 mΩ cm at room temperature and zero resistance at 96 K. The coatings had a magnetic transition near 80 K, with a weak diamagnetic signal up to 112 K. Superconductivity in the coatings was associated with two distinct phases, one of which was not identified. Scanning electron microscopy, x-ray diffraction, electrical resistivity, and magnetic measurements were used to characterize the coatings.

    Notizen: Abstract A method is reported for producing an orthorhombic YBa2Cu3O7−x single crystal comprised entirely of a single untwinned domain. The transformation from a polydomain to a single domain single crystal is carried out by applying uniaxial pressure of approximately 25 MPa for about one minute at 450°C in an oxygen atmosphere. We report on some of the superconducting properties of crystals produced in this way.

    Notizen: Abstract We have investigated heat conduction of single crystal Ba1−xKxBiO3 in the temperature range of 2–300 K and in a magnetic field of up to 6 Tesla. Temperature dependence of thermal conductivityκ(T) reveals the participation of both electrons and phonons with their relative contributions that depend critically on the potassium doping concentration. Crystals underdoped with potassium (samples with higherT c) exhibit a strong suppression ofκ and a glass-like temperature dependence. In contrast, those with a higher potassium content (lowerT c) show an increase as temperature decreases with a peak near 23 K. Field dependence ofκ(H) is also very sensitive to the level of potassium doping. Crystals exhibiting a large phonon contribution show an initial drop inκ(H) at low fields followed by a minimum and then a slow rise to saturation as the field increases. The initial drop is due to the additional phonon scattering by magnetic vortices as the sample enters a mixed state. The high field behavior ofκ(H), arising from a continuous break-up of Cooper pairs, exhibits scaling which suggests the presence of an unconventional superconducting gap structure in this material.
